1985 Audi 100 vs. 2010 Citroen C3

To start off, 2010 Citroen C3 is newer by 25 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1985 Audi 100.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1985 Audi 100 would be higher. At 1,986 cc (5 cylinders), 1985 Audi 100 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, both vehicles can yield 70 horse power. So under normal driving conditions, the acceleration of both vehicles should be relatively similar.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1985 Audi 100 weights approximately 238 kg more than 2010 Citroen C3.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2010 Citroen C3 (147 Nm @ 1750 RPM) has 24 more torque (in Nm) than 1985 Audi 100. (123 Nm @ 2800 RPM). This means 2010 Citroen C3 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1985 Audi 100.
